USE ADVANCED FEATURES
Recording and Playing Outgoing Messages and
Music
1.
Switch the Headset/Handset selector to Headset.
Depress the Telephone/Compute
r Audio Switch
(colored indicator showing),and the
Microphone Selection Switch (colored indicator
showing).
2 Use your audio device to control recording,play-
back and volume.
3 To interrupt or take over the phone call,simply
release the Microphone Selection Switch (no
colored indicator showing).
Note: Some computer soundcards have
“local loop back, which means your callers
can hear what you’re saying. Do not assume
that your caller can not hear you.
Recording a Call
1.Depress the Telephone/Computer Audio Switch
(colored indicator showing) and make sure the
rest of your settings are in default.
2.Record using your external audio device.Your
side of the conversation may be quiet depend-
ing on the make and style of your phone.
Note:To control recording volume,consult your
audio device user manual.
